**Q: How does Vaultwren rotate secrets, and what happens if rotation fails mid-cycle?**

Vaultwren rotates credentials every 72 hours via the Larkspur scheduler. Failed rotations roll back automatically; two consecutive failures freeze the affected namespace and page the on-call. Manual override requires quorum approval from two members of the Copperfield security group. Audit logs stream to the Nettlebay archive and are immutable for one year. If the rotation keystore itself becomes unreadable, recovery uses the offline passphrase below.

recovery phrase for bawef-haduf: wenax-druox-julmir

This client talks to the internal
// Stationgrid service, which returns live bike counts per dock and the
// planned truck routes for the next two hours. Please note: every query is
// logged with your support handle, and write operations (manual rebalance
// overrides) require a second approver in the console. Rate limits are
// strict — 60 reads per minute — so batch your lookups where possible.
// Authenticate using the key directly below.

API key for yahig-tadup: kto7_ubizbYm

TICKET-4471: Autocomplete index latency in Querrel suggest service. P95 lookup jumped from 40ms to 900ms after the trigram index rebuild on Tuesday. Suspect the new tokenizer is indexing raw query strings before the redaction pass runs, which is also why this is flagged for security review — unredacted fragments may persist in index shards. Mitigation: rebuild with redaction-first ordering; shards older than the cutover should be purged. Flagging for review before we rotate anything. Reference trace for the offending rebuild follows.

trace token, fafog-kageg: htk4_98e6